PPE (PolyPhenyleneEther)
PPE (Noryl®) is a thermoplastic, amorphous standard plastic and is mostly used modified with the addition of PA or PS.
The addition of glass fibres increases the properties such as hardness, compressive strength and dimensional accuracy.
PPE is primarily used in the electronics, household and vehicle sectors where high heat resistance, dimensional stability and dimensional stability are important. However, PPE is also used in medical technology, such as plastic instruments that are frequently sterilized.
Properties
The properties of PPE (Noryl®) are:- High impact resistance
- Heat distortion temperature up to + 130 ° C
- Good hydrolysis resistance
- Low water absorption
- Good electrical and dielectric properties
- Physiologically harmless (BGA-FDA approval)
- Sterilizable
- Low density
- Good dimensional stability
- High chemical resistance
- Lack of oxidative resistance above 100 ° C
- Lack of resistance to UV radiation
Applications
PPE (Noryl®) can be used in the following areas:- Electrical appliances
- Electric engineering
- Elements for sanitary and bathing areas (steam)
- Components in precision engineering
- Household appliances
